The Infinix Zero Ultra is a smartphone that marries aesthetics with functionality, boasting a sleek design that appeals to modern sensibilities. Available in two color variants, Coslight Silver and Genesis Noir, the device offers dimensions that cater to a comfortable grip. The Coslight Silver variant has a dimension of 165.5 x 74.5 x 8.8 mm, while the Genesis Noir measures slightly more at 165.5 x 75.1 x 9.2 mm. Weighing 213 grams, it feels substantial yet not overly heavy, making it ideal for daily use.
The phone is equipped with Corning Gorilla Glass 3 for protection, ensuring durability against scratches and minor impacts. Additionally, the dual SIM capability (Nano-SIM, dual stand-by) adds versatility for users who prefer managing two numbers within one device.
The Infinix Zero Ultra features a large 6.8-inch AMOLED display with a 120Hz refresh rate and 900 nits of peak brightness (HBM), which ensures vivid visuals and smooth scrolling. With a screen-to-body ratio of approximately 90.5%, the display offers an immersive viewing experience, making it excellent for gaming, streaming videos, and browsing.
The resolution stands at 1080 x 2400 pixels with a 20:9 aspect ratio (~387 ppi density), providing sharp and crisp images. The AMOLED technology ensures deep blacks and vibrant colors, enhancing visual content quality.
Under the hood, the Infinix Zero Ultra is powered by the Mediatek Dimensity 920 chipset, built on a 6 nm process. This octa-core processor includes two Cortex-A78 cores clocked at 2.5 GHz and six Cortex-A55 cores at 2.0 GHz, enabling efficient multitasking and a smooth overall experience.
The Mali-G68 MC4 GPU handles gaming and graphic-intensive tasks, ensuring a responsive gaming experience even with demanding titles. Coupled with 8GB of RAM, the phone can manage multiple applications running simultaneously without significant slowdowns.
The camera setup on the Infinix Zero Ultra is impressive, particularly with its 200 MP main sensor (f/2.0, 1/1.22" sensor size) that includes dual pixel PDAF and OIS. This ensures high-quality images with excellent detail, even in low-light conditions. Accompanying the primary sensor is a 13 MP ultrawide lens (f/2.4) with autofocus, and a 2 MP lens to complete the triple-camera system. The camera supports features like Dual-LED flash, HDR, and panorama, and it can record videos in 4K at 30fps and 1080p at both 30 and 60fps.
For selfies, there's a 32 MP front-facing camera (f/2.0) equipped with a Dual-LED flash, capable of capturing 1080p videos at 30fps.
The battery life of the Infinix Zero Ultra is supported by a 4500 mAh non-removable battery. What truly sets it apart is the 180W wired charging capability, which can charge the phone to 100% in just 12 minutes, as advertised. This feature is incredibly beneficial for users who are constantly on the go and need to recharge quickly.
The device comes with 256GB of internal storage, providing ample space for apps, photos, videos, and other data. However, it does not support expandable storage via a microSD card slot, so users will rely on the internal storage capacity. With 8GB of RAM, the phone delivers robust multitasking capabilities.
The Infinix Zero Ultra runs on Android 12 with Infinix's custom XOS 12 skin. This combination offers a user-friendly experience with several customization options and features that cater to both efficiency and visual appeal. The user interface is streamlined, providing smooth navigation and intuitive access to essential functions.
The phone supports the latest connectivity options, including Wi-Fi 802.11 a/b/g/n/ac/6 and Bluetooth. It also features NFC (depending on the market or region), which can be used for contactless payments and data transfer. The USB Type-C 2.0 port supports OTG, allowing for easy connection of external peripherals.
Network support is extensive, with compatibility across GSM, HSPA, LTE, and 5G bands, offering fast internet speeds and excellent call quality. The phone also includes GPS for accurate location services and an FM radio for traditional media consumption.
The Infinix Zero Ultra is equipped with an under-display, optical fingerprint sensor, providing secure and convenient unlocking. It also includes sensors for accelerometer, gyro, proximity, and compass, contributing to the device's overall functionality.
However, it lacks a 3.5mm headphone jack, aligning with the industry trend towards wireless audio solutions. The device compensates with dual speakers for a stereo sound experience.
